类似于CMD窗口的易语言命令,但是CMD想运用到易语言怎么办?废话本多说,上一张CMD调用的代码图(图在最下)。
能把执行的命令返回到易语言一个变量里面,可以直接调用出来.
下面代码是执行:ipconfig
Windows IP 配置
以太网适配器 本地连接:
连接特定的 DNS 后缀 . . . . . . . :
本地链接 IPv6 地址. . . . . . . . : 0080::0070:809:0702:e1c1%10
IPv4 地址 . . . . . . . . . . . . : 192.168.3.104
子网掩码 . . . . . . . . . . . . : 255.255.255.0
默认网关. . . . . . . . . . . . . : 192.168.3.1
源码内容
1
2
3
4
5
6
7
8
|
.版本 2
.子程序 DOS回执, 文本型, 公开, 这里是返回的数据
.参数 命令, 文本型, , 欲执行的命令 如:ipconfig
写到文件 (“C:\1.bat”, 到字节集 (命令 + “ > c:\a.txt”))
运行 (“C:\1.bat”, 真, #隐藏窗口)
返回 (到文本 (读入文件 (“C:\a.txt”)))
|